#25034, "A couple of legacy questions"


          

One with shadows
Does this legacy only trigger on "surprise attacks" or does it get checked anytime anyone initiates combat with you? And is it prime stat wisdom?

Balance of the sisters
Can you use exotic skills from your offhand using this legacy? would be nifty to see batter plus riposte hehe.

>One with shadows
> Does this legacy only trigger on "surprise attacks" or does
>it get checked anytime anyone initiates combat with you? And
>is it prime stat wisdom?

Surprise attacks. Yes, wisdom.

>Balance of the sisters
> Can you use exotic skills from your offhand using this
>legacy? would be nifty to see batter plus riposte hehe.

No.

What kinds of situations are deemed "surprise" attacks? For example, is it a surprise attack if you couldn't see your attacker before he initiated?

#25039, "Does assassinate count?"
In response to Reply #2


          

I've seen it fire on blackjack (prevented working), ambush (didn't prevent, just riposted) and strangle (prevented working). But I have no idea if it'll actually stop assassinate when it fires.

It's a number of specific skills generally associated with stealth or surprise attacks.

Yes, assassinate is included.
